Why I Connect My Kindle to Wi-Fi

I connect my Kindle to Wi-Fi because it makes reading much easier and more enjoyable. When my Kindle is online, I can quickly download new books, samples, and updates without needing a computer. It saves me time, and I can start reading right away whenever I find a book I want.

I also use Wi-Fi to sync my reading progress across devices. If I stop reading on my Kindle and later open the Kindle app on my phone, I can continue from the same page. That convenience helps me keep track of my books and never lose my place.

Another reason I connect to Wi-Fi is to access useful features like dictionary lookups, cloud storage, and software updates. My Kindle works better when it stays updated, and Wi-Fi helps me get the latest improvements. For me, it is an important part of getting the full Kindle experience.

What I Look For First

When I want to connect to Wi-Fi on my Kindle, I first make sure I have the right network name and password ready. I also check whether my Kindle is charged and close to the router, because a weak battery or poor signal can make the connection process frustrating.

How I Check Kindle Wi-Fi Compatibility

Before I try to connect, I confirm that my Kindle model supports the Wi-Fi band my router uses. Most Kindles work well with standard home Wi-Fi, but if I have a newer router with advanced settings, I make sure it is broadcasting a compatible network. This saves me time if the Kindle is not detecting the Wi-Fi right away.

My Steps to Connect

I usually go to the Kindle home screen, open Settings, and tap Wi-Fi or Wireless. Then I turn Wi-Fi on, wait for the available networks to appear, and choose my network. After that, I enter the password carefully and wait for the Kindle to confirm the connection. If it connects successfully, I can start downloading books and syncing my library.

What I Do If It Won’t Connect

If my Kindle does not connect, I restart both the Kindle and the router first. I also double-check the password, because even one wrong character can stop the connection. If the problem continues, I forget the network and reconnect, or I move closer to the router to improve the signal.
